Records team: the scheduled collection of three loaned exhibition pieces from the Averdale Gallery did not take place on Friday. The pieces — two framed studies and one glass case from the Hollis-Marne collection — remain in secure storage, crated and sealed. Loan paperwork has been extended by one week with the lender's agreement. A new collection is booked with Stonegate Couriers for Wednesday. Before release, the courier must comply with the confidential hand-over instruction set out directly below.

dispatch memo: the eliath belael courier leaves the praox ledger at gate 8841 under passcode 017589

# SeatGrid Renderer — Limits & Quotas

SeatGrid draws the Pellworth Playhouse seat maps client-side. Hard limits exist so one venue layout can't stall the render loop. Don't raise them per-venue; file a ticket instead. Zoom tiles are cached per session; eviction is LRU. SVG export is capped separately and fails fast rather than truncating. Exceeding any quota returns a render error, not a partial map. Current constants are set as follows.

tuning table, kajog-bawip:
TIERS = {
    "kelius": 256,
    "lammir": 543,
}

Studio access — contractors

The Larkfen recording studio (Room B4, Ostermill Building) is for training-video shoots only. Book slots via the Driftbell portal. Phones silenced, door light on while recording. Do not adjust the acoustic panels. Leave the space as found and log your hours at the desk. To unlock the studio door, use the code below.

staff pass of kawip-hawef = bdg-QLP-2

INTERNAL MEMO — Launch Plan: Calderbright Flow 2

To: Sales Leads
From: Product Office, Tessler Instruments

The Flow 2 metering unit launches in the Averholt region on 12 March, with national rollout six weeks later. Demo kits ship to branches by end of February; pricing sheets follow once final margin approval clears. Please schedule customer previews only after training certification, as early feedback will shape the phased messaging. Hold all external commitments until you have read the note that follows.

board note of kageg-bahof: The renewal with Holwynax Holdings closes at $2 million a year, 5 percent below the last contract. Project Ulaath slips by two quarters because of the supplier delay.